Estes Park

A family-friendly stay in the heart of Estes Park awaits you at this holiday home. You'll be 1.6 km (1 mi) from The Stanley Hotel and 2.8 km (1.7 mi) from Rocky Mountain National Park. Highlights at this holiday home include a kitchen, a washing machine and a patio. .Home features a TV, a coffee/tea maker and a desk. In-room dining is easy with a kitchen that comes equipped with a fridge, a microwave and a stovetop. .Sights within a 15-minute walk of this Estes Park holiday home include Historic Estes Park and Mrs. Walsh's Garden.

Vintage Cabin with Hot Tub, Convenient in-Town Location & Mountain Views! R#3511

We purchased the Spruce Drive Cabin in 2015 and have been hard at work restoring it to its original charm ever since.

Location, Location, Location!! Including Town, National Park, Shops, Restaurants, the famous Stanley Hotel, Fall River and more...

Our cabin is within a VERY EASY walk to all that the Town center of Estes Park has to offer. Shop to your heart's content, head to some of your favorite restaurants and check-out the local festivals, parades, farmer's market and special events... all with no parking worries!

Plus we are only a 5 minute drive to the Fall River and Beaver Meadows entrances of The Rocky Mountain National Park.

Enjoy mountain views from the hot tub after a day of hiking! Take in the wildlife that meanders through the neighborhood! Or simply take in the ambiance of a vintage Estes Park neighborhood and the Spruce Drive Cabin!!

PS We live close-by and are available to assist you with your stay.

6/10 Okay

Jennifer P.

Liked: Cleanliness
Rustic, a few small items, but overall worked well for us
This place was the perfect size and location for me, my husband, and my 3 adult children!! Over all we really enjoyed the place!! The place was very clean and cute! Had everything that was indicated on the file. There are a few things that could use some attention, but it didn’t hamper our stay at all! The 2 right side burners of the stove weren’t working. We did see some mouse droppings in some of the kitchen drawers… not a surprise in a house this old. There was a lot of clutter in the kitchen and desk drawers… seems like it could be tidied up some and throw out some junk. We found that same concern outside.. just some stuff that could be cleaned up and make the property so much nicer. Also, the mattresses in the loft aren’t the best. If you have little kids, probably ok, but not for an adult/larger kid. Our son wasn’t very comfortable. The front door lock wasn’t working correctly with the key.. we had to use the code the whole time cause the key would just spin in the handle. But honestly, overall we really enjoyed the place and it was in a great location to the downtown and the view of the mountains was nice!!! We would definitely stay here again. Just could be so much better with a bit of TLC.
